Mr Francis was flying his kite when a freak accident caused him to be lifted off the ground 6 feet before falling on his head. He shattered several vertebrae, broke his left wrist, suffered broken ribs and bruising. Mr Francis was initially told that he would never walk again. He underwent operations on his wrist, had a steel rod inserted in his back and had operations to realign vertebrae with titanium bracing.
Mr Francis was determined that he would be able to walk again and began a 2 year recovery period aided by the financial and rehabilitation support available from Aviva's Income Protection policy.
